表单中<a href="form.jsp?method=update&id=<%=u.getId() %>">更新</a>中method的作用是什么?

可以改成别的吗?

你这句的意思是当点击“更新”按钮时页面提交并跳转的form.jsp进行业务处理。
传递了两个参数method和id。
method的值为update
id的值为u.getId ()
form.jsp里根据method的值来判断执行哪段业务代码,因为值为update,所以执行表单的修改操作。
我猜想你页面应该有这样的代码:
if(method.equals("update")){executeUpdate("update 表 set……")……}//当method值为update时修改表内的相应数据。
温馨提示:内容为网友见解,仅供参考
第1个回答  2011-03-31
这是struts中使用DispatchAction动态跳转中必需传递的参数值,至于method这个字符它是和配置文件中的paramter属性所指定的值必须一致的
相似回答